Boos heard in Philly after Iverson sits out BIG3 game

Philadelphia 76ers fans were treated to a huge disappointment when the BIG3 league came through town on Sunday.

76ers legend Allen Iverson, who plays for team 3's Company, announced 25 minutes before tipoff that he would not play on account of advice from his doctor.

However, many fans were unaware until arriving at the arena, and the mood quickly soured inside of Wells Fargo Center as Iverson's glaring absence dawned on them.

Iverson was treated to a warm ovation as he was announced, but the player-coach spent the entire game on the sidelines directing his team.

Fans chanted, "We want AI" and "Do it for Philly", but Iverson wasn't moved, writes Teddy Bailey of Philly.com. A smattering of boos rang out as unhappy Sixers fans were robbed of a chance to see their former franchise player.

The lower bowl was packed before tipoff but had emptied out by halftime as it became apparent Iverson wasn't suiting up.
